Output e95a480d33839f188ceb4f2a9a0462d9fef1ea896cdce28136cfb4b001d8b066:0

value
159837
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58485569580800cf195f25ceae100573960c71db OP_EQUAL
address
39jp3FhECRZ5jFZeueHnbXn2jZj8MFUYo9
transaction
e95a480d33839f188ceb4f2a9a0462d9fef1ea896cdce28136cfb4b001d8b066
confirmations
173777
spent
true